
CBC Hierarchical Bayes Module
CBC/HB is a tool for estimating individual-level results for CBC experiments. It may also be used for analyzing discrete choice data not designed or collected using Sawtooth Software’s tools. Because having individual-level utility data is so helpful for improving the general results of CBC studies, especially the validity of market simulators, most CBC users also employ CBC/HB analysis.

CBC/HB System:
- Up to 1000 attributes or parameters per individual
- Up to 1000 alternatives per choice task
- Maximum of 1000 levels for any one attribute
- Up to 1000 tasks per respondent
- Effects-coding, dummy-coding, linear coding, or user-specified coding
- Can impose utility (monotonicity) constraints
- Can include first-order interactions
- Supports chip-allocation, MaxDiff, dual-response None
